RBC Canadian Open: First Round Leader Picks
The RBC Canadian Open is being played at TPC Toronto at Osprey Valley. The RBC Canadian Open is one of the longest-running events on the PGA Tour. This will be the first time that TPC Toronto has ever hosted this event. TPC Toronto at Osprey Valley is a par 70 golf course and ranges 7,389 yards, one of the longest courses on the PGA Tour. The course requires a strategic approach from players due to the tough bunker placement and tricky chipping areas around the greens. There will be a full field of 156 players with a standard cut after Friday’s round. This field will be headlined by Rory McIlroy, who makes his first start since the PGA Championship. Other top players in the field include Ludvig Aberg, Shane Lowry and Justin Rose, along with the hometown Canadian favorites, Nick Taylor and Corey Conners. Scottie Scheffler, along with many other top players, is taking the week off to rest before next week’s US Open.
Shane Lowry FRL (+3500)
Shane Lowry has been one of the best players in the world this season. Lowry has always been a great player, but he seems to have found a level of comfort with his game that is allowing him to thrive on a weekly basis. In 13 events played this season, Lowry had nine top-25 finishes and four top-10 finishes. Lowry has also been a quick-starter this season, making him ideal for a first-round leader bet. Over the last few weeks, he shot opening rounds of 64, 64 and 69 at the Zurich, Truist and Memorial, respectively. Lowry ranks fifth on the PGA Tour in strokes gained total and third in strokes gained approach to green this season. To avoid the tricky bunkers around the green, players will need to be on target with their irons, and Lowry is one of the best in the world with his irons. Shane Lowry also has three top-12 finishes in six career starts at the RBC Canadian Open. Lowry has a great chance to go low and jump out to a first-round lead on Thursday.
Nick Taylor FRL (+5500)
The Canadian players in the field always get extra attention the week of the RBC Canadian Open. Corey Conners is the best Canadian player on the PGA Tour this season, but Nick Taylor is the local hero at this tournament. Taylor won the 2023 RBC Canadian Open, the first Canadian to win the event in nearly 70 years. Those fond memories should make Taylor feel comfortable and confident playing in this tournament. It has also been a solid start to the season for Taylor, who currently ranks 16th in the FedEx Cup standings. In 15 starts in 2025, Taylor has seven top-25 finishes, including a win at the Sony Open in Hawaii. Nick Taylor also played fantastically last week at The Memorial in tough conditions, finishing fourth in that field. Taylor is 13th on the PGA Tour in strokes gained approach to green this season, that all-important stat for this course, where Lowry also thrives. With the crowd behind him, Taylor is worth a longshot bet to go low and be the first-round leader at the RBC Canadian Open.
